Description

45% shared ownership, buyer criteria apply. Built in 2020, this modern semi-detached home offers a comfortable and well-connected lifestyle, thoughtfully arranged across two floors. The ground level opens into a bright and spacious open-plan area that combines the kitchen, dining and living spaces, featuring sleek white gloss units and wood-effect worktops for a clean, contemporary feel. A downstairs WC adds everyday convenience. Upstairs, two generously sized double bedrooms provide flexible accommodation, served by a stylish family bathroom. Outside, the enclosed rear garden includes a patio, lawn and a storage shed, while the property also benefits from two allocated off-road parking spaces. Located close to supermarkets, schools and daily amenities, with Wymondham’s historic town centre just a short distance away, this home could suit a range of buyers, particularly those in a position to proceed without a chain.

Location

Magpie Place is positioned within a popular residential area on the edge of Wymondham, offering convenient access to local schools, supermarkets, and everyday amenities. The historic town centre is just a short distance away, where you’ll find a selection of independent shops, cafés, and eateries, along with Wymondham Abbey and scenic riverside walks. The location benefits from excellent transport links, including nearby bus routes and Wymondham train station, providing direct services into Norwich, Cambridge, and beyond, making it ideal for commuters and families alike.
